About Cuiling Zhang
Cuiling Zhang is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Immunology, Physiology, Oncology and Hematology, having authored 26 papers that have together received 1.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ced biosensing and bioanalysis techniques (6 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(5 papers), Mast cells and histamine (3 papers), Asthma and respiratory diseases (3 papers), Luminescence and Fluorescent Materials (2 papers), Epigenetics and DNA Methylation (2 papers), CAR-T cell therapy research (2 papers) and RNA Research and Splicing (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biological Psychiatry (70 citations), Immunology (441 citations), Behavioral Neuroscience (59 citations), Rheumatology (246 citations) and Physiology (399 citations). Cuiling Zhang has collaborated with scholars based in United States, China and France. Frequent co-authors include Andrew Wang, Ruslan Medzhitov, Shuang Yu, Harding H. Luan, Carmen J. Booth, Sarah C. Huen, Jean-Dominique Gallezot, Brandon K. Hilliard, Amy M. Ahasic and Lawrence H. Young. Their work appears in journals such as Cell, The Journal of Immunology, Sensors and Actuators B Chemical, Immunity and Analytical Chemistry.
